fun View.onVisibilityChange(
viewGroups: List<ViewGroup> = emptyList(), // 会被插入 Fragment 的容器集合
needScrollListener: Boolean = true,
block: (view: View, isVisible: Boolean) -> Unit
) {
val KEY_VISIBILITY = "KEY_VISIBILITY".hashCode()
val KEY_HAS_LISTENER = "KEY_HAS_LISTENER".hashCode()
// 若当前控件已监听可见性,则返回
if (getTag(KEY_HAS_LISTENER) == true) return
// 检测可见性
val checkVisibility = {
// 获取上一次可见性
val lastVisibility = getTag(KEY_VISIBILITY) as? Boolean
// 判断控件是否出现在屏幕中
val isInScreen = this.isInScreen
// 首次可见性变更
if (lastVisibility == null) {
if (isInScreen) {
block(this, true)
setTag(KEY_VISIBILITY, true)
}
}
// 非首次可见性变更
else if (lastVisibility != isInScreen) {
block(this, isInScreen)
setTag(KEY_VISIBILITY, isInScreen)
}
}
// 全局重绘监听器
class LayoutListener : ViewTreeObserver.OnGlobalLayoutListener {
// 标记位用于区别是否是遮挡case
var addedView: View? = null
override fun onGlobalLayout() {
// 遮挡 case
if (addedView != null) {
// 插入视图矩形区域
val addedRect = Rect().also { addedView?.getGlobalVisibleRect(it) }
// 当前视图矩形区域
val rect = Rect().also { this@onVisibilityChange.getGlobalVisibleRect(it) }
// 如果插入视图矩形区域包含当前视图矩形区域,则视为当前控件不可见
if (addedRect.contains(rect)) {
block(this@onVisibilityChange, false)
setTag(KEY_VISIBILITY, false)
} else {
block(this@onVisibilityChange, true)
setTag(KEY_VISIBILITY, true)
}
}
// 非遮挡 case
else {
checkVisibility()
}
}
}
val layoutListener = LayoutListener()
// 编辑容器监听其插入视图时机
viewGroups.forEachIndexed { index, viewGroup ->
viewGroup.setOnHierarchyChangeListener(object : ViewGroup.OnHierarchyChangeListener {
override fun onChildViewAdded(parent: View?, child: View?) {
// 当控件插入,则置标记位
layoutListener.addedView = child
}
override fun onChildViewRemoved(parent: View?, child: View?) {
// 当控件移除,则置标记位
layoutListener.addedView = null
}
})
}
viewTreeObserver.addOnGlobalLayoutListener(layoutListener)
// 全局滚动监听器
var scrollListener:ViewTreeObserver.OnScrollChangedListener? = null
if (needScrollListener) {
scrollListener = ViewTreeObserver.OnScrollChangedListener { checkVisibility() }
viewTreeObserver.addOnScrollChangedListener(scrollListener)
}
// 全局焦点变化监听器
val focusChangeListener = ViewTreeObserver.OnWindowFocusChangeListener { hasFocus ->
val lastVisibility = getTag(KEY_VISIBILITY) as? Boolean
val isInScreen = this.isInScreen
if (hasFocus) {
if (lastVisibility != isInScreen) {
block(this, isInScreen)
setTag(KEY_VISIBILITY, isInScreen)
}
} else {
if (lastVisibility == true) {
block(this, false)
setTag(KEY_VISIBILITY, false)
}
}
}
viewTreeObserver.addOnWindowFocusChangeListener(focusChangeListener)
// 为避免内存泄漏,当视图被移出的同时反注册监听器
addOnAttachStateChangeListener(object : View.OnAttachStateChangeListener {
override fun onViewAttachedToWindow(v: View?) {
}
override fun onViewDetachedFromWindow(v: View?) {
v ?: return
// 有时候 View detach 后,还会执行全局重绘,为此退后反注册
post {
try {
v.viewTreeObserver.removeOnGlobalLayoutListener(layoutListener)
} catch (_: java.lang.Exception) {
v.viewTreeObserver.removeGlobalOnLayoutListener(layoutListener)
}
v.viewTreeObserver.removeOnWindowFocusChangeListener(focusChangeListener)
if(scrollListener !=null) v.viewTreeObserver.removeOnScrollChangedListener(scrollListener)
viewGroups.forEach { it.setOnHierarchyChangeListener(null) }
}
removeOnAttachStateChangeListener(this)
}
})
// 标记已设置监听器
setTag(KEY_HAS_LISTENER, true)
}
